PURPOSE:To increase the reaction rate and to reform methanol in conformity to the purpose by using a catalyst obtained by hot-melt-spray-coating a metal or alloy material with a multiple oxide of copper or zinc and nickel to produce a hydrogen-contg. gas from methanol. CONSTITUTION:A hydrogen-contg. gas is produced from methanol or a mixture of methanol and water. A catalyst obtained by hot-melt-spray-coating a metal or alloy material with a multiple oxide of Cu and/or zinc and nickel is used in this method. Since a catalytic component is deposited on the metal or alloy material, the catalyst is excellent in heat transfer. Especially when a heat- transfer tube carrying the catalytic component is used to reform methanol on the catalytic surface of the tube, the heat transfer function and catalytic action are simultaneously exhibited, and methanol is reformed in conformity to the purpose. |
